Purpose of the Role

We're seeking a proactive and detail-oriented Sales Co-ordinator to join a well-established sales team based in Dorchester. This is a key role focused on delivering smooth and accurate processing of customer orders, supporting international trade activity, and contributing to outstanding customer service across global markets.

You’ll work closely with internal teams and international distributors to manage enquiries, generate documentation, and help ensure customers receive their orders efficiently and accurately.

Key Responsibilities

  • Act as a key point of contact for customers via phone, email, and web chat
  • Manage incoming enquiries, quotations, pro-forma invoices, and order acknowledgements
  • Maintain and update customer data within a CRM system
  • Forward leads to distributors and follow up on quotes and pro-forma orders
  • Support with dispatch and export procedures, including packing and invoicing
  • Administer training certificates and assist with customer training coordination
  • Support wider sales activities such as loan/demo stock management and calibration reminders
  • Attend trade exhibitions occasionally

What We’re Looking For

  • Experience in a sales administration or order processing role
  • Familiarity with CRM systems and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, PowerPoint)
  • Interest in international trade and export processes
  • Organised, accurate, and customer-focused
  • A can-do attitude with eagerness to learn and grow within the role
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
